package org.apache.camel.core.osgi;
import org.apache.camel.CamelContext;
import org.apache.camel.NoSuchLanguageException;
import org.apache.camel.RuntimeCamelException;
import org.apache.camel.spi.Language;
import org.apache.camel.spi.LanguageResolver;
import org.apache.camel.support.ResolverHelper;
import org.osgi.framework.BundleContext;
import org.osgi.framework.InvalidSyntaxException;
import org.osgi.framework.ServiceReference;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
public class OsgiLanguageResolver implements LanguageResolver {
private static final Logger LOG = LoggerFactory.getLogger(OsgiLanguageResolver.class);
private final BundleContext bundleContext;
public OsgiLanguageResolver(BundleContext bundleContext) {
this.bundleContext = bundleContext;
}
public Language resolveLanguage(String name, CamelContext context) {
// lookup in registry first
Language lang = ResolverHelper.lookupLanguageInRegistryWithFallback(context, name);
if (lang != null) {
return lang;
}
lang = getLanguage(name, context);
if (lang != null) {
return lang;
}
LanguageResolver resolver = getLanguageResolver("default", context);
if (resolver != null) {
return resolver.resolveLanguage(name, context);
}
throw new NoSuchLanguageException(name);
}
protected Language getLanguage(String name, CamelContext context) {
LOG.trace("Finding Language: {}", name);
try {
ServiceReference<?>[] refs = bundleContext.getServiceReferences(LanguageResolver.class.getName(), "(language=" + name + ")");
if (refs != null) {
for (ServiceReference<?> ref : refs) {
Object service = bundleContext.getService(ref);
if (LanguageResolver.class.isAssignableFrom(service.getClass())) {
LanguageResolver resolver = (LanguageResolver) service;
return resolver.resolveLanguage(name, context);
}
}
}
return null;
} catch (InvalidSyntaxException e) {
throw RuntimeCamelException.wrapRuntimeCamelException(e);
}
}
protected LanguageResolver getLanguageResolver(String name, CamelContext context) {
LOG.trace("Finding LanguageResolver: {}", name);
try {
ServiceReference<?>[] refs = bundleContext.getServiceReferences(LanguageResolver.class.getName(), "(resolver=" + name + ")");
if (refs != null) {
for (ServiceReference<?> ref : refs) {
Object service = bundleContext.getService(ref);
if (LanguageResolver.class.isAssignableFrom(service.getClass())) {
LanguageResolver resolver = (LanguageResolver) service;
return resolver;
}
}
}
return null;
} catch (InvalidSyntaxException e) {
throw RuntimeCamelException.wrapRuntimeCamelException(e);
}
}
}
